Plaster Accelerator Market Summary

As per Market Research Future analysis, the Plaster Accelerator Market Size was estimated at 1.756 USD Billion in 2024. The Plaster Accelerator industry is projected to grow from 1.847 USD Billion in 2025 to 3.055 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 5.16% during the forecast period 2025 - 2035

Key Market Trends & Highlights

The Plaster Accelerator Market is experiencing robust growth driven by technological advancements and increasing demand for sustainable construction practices.

  • North America remains the largest market for plaster accelerators, driven by extensive construction activities.
  • Asia-Pacific is the fastest-growing region, reflecting rapid urbanization and infrastructure development.
  • Chemical accelerators dominate the market, while physical accelerators are emerging as the fastest-growing segment.
  • Rising construction activities and a growing focus on speed and efficiency are key drivers propelling market expansion.

Market Size & Forecast

2024 Market Size 1.756 (USD Billion)
2035 Market Size 3.055 (USD Billion)
CAGR (2025 - 2035) 5.16%

Major Players

Saint-Gobain (FR), BASF (DE), Sika AG (CH), Knauf Gips KG (DE), USG Corporation (US), LafargeHolcim (CH), Cemex (MX), Fischer (DE), Boral Limited (AU)

Regional Insights

North America : Construction Growth Driver

North America is witnessing robust growth in the plaster accelerator market, driven by a booming construction sector and increasing demand for quick-setting materials. The region holds approximately 40% of the global market share, making it the largest market. Regulatory support for sustainable building practices further fuels this growth, as governments push for eco-friendly construction materials. The United States and Canada are the leading countries in this region, with major players like USG Corporation and Saint-Gobain dominating the market. The competitive landscape is characterized by innovation and strategic partnerships among key players, ensuring a steady supply of advanced plaster accelerator products to meet rising construction demands.

Europe : Innovation and Sustainability Focus

Europe is emerging as a significant player in the plaster accelerator market, driven by stringent regulations promoting sustainability and innovation in construction. The region accounts for about 30% of the global market share, making it the second-largest market. The European Union's Green Deal and various national initiatives encourage the use of eco-friendly materials, boosting demand for plaster accelerators that meet these standards. Germany, France, and the UK are the leading countries in this market, with key players like BASF and Knauf Gips KG leading the charge. The competitive landscape is marked by a focus on research and development, with companies investing heavily in innovative solutions to enhance product performance and sustainability. This dynamic environment fosters collaboration among industry stakeholders to meet evolving market needs.

Asia-Pacific : Rapid Urbanization and Growth

Asia-Pacific is experiencing rapid urbanization, significantly driving the plaster accelerator market. The region holds approximately 25% of the global market share, fueled by increasing infrastructure projects and a growing demand for efficient construction materials. Government initiatives aimed at enhancing urban infrastructure further catalyze market growth, as countries invest in modernization and development. China and India are the leading countries in this region, with a strong presence of key players like Sika AG and LafargeHolcim. The competitive landscape is characterized by a mix of local and international companies, all vying for market share. The focus on innovation and cost-effective solutions is paramount, as companies strive to meet the diverse needs of a rapidly growing construction sector.

Middle East and Africa : Emerging Market Opportunities

The Middle East and Africa region is witnessing a surge in the plaster accelerator market, driven by increasing construction activities and infrastructure development. This region holds about 5% of the global market share, with significant growth potential as governments invest in large-scale projects. Regulatory frameworks are evolving to support sustainable construction practices, further enhancing market opportunities. Countries like the UAE and South Africa are at the forefront of this growth, with key players such as Cemex and Boral Limited actively participating in the market. The competitive landscape is characterized by a mix of established companies and emerging local players, all focused on delivering innovative plaster solutions to meet the demands of a growing construction industry.

In August 2025, Sika AG (CH) announced the launch of a new line of eco-friendly plaster accelerators designed to reduce carbon emissions during application. This strategic move not only aligns with global sustainability trends but also positions Sika AG as a leader in environmentally responsible construction solutions. The introduction of these products is likely to enhance their market appeal, particularly among environmentally conscious consumers and contractors.

In September 2025, BASF (DE) unveiled a partnership with a leading construction technology firm to integrate AI-driven analytics into their plaster accelerator formulations. This collaboration aims to optimize product performance and tailor solutions to specific construction needs. By leveraging advanced technology, BASF (DE) appears to be enhancing its competitive edge, potentially leading to improved customer satisfaction and loyalty.

In July 2025, Saint-Gobain (FR) expanded its manufacturing capabilities in Eastern Europe, focusing on the production of high-performance plaster accelerators. This expansion is indicative of the company's strategy to penetrate emerging markets and respond to the growing demand for rapid construction materials in the region. Such moves are likely to bolster Saint-Gobain's market presence and operational efficiency.
